Stephen Boulet wrote: > > When I try executing this program, I get the message: > > #!/opt/python/bin/python > > print "Hello, Python!" > > gives: > > Could not find platform dependent libraries <exec_prefix> > Consider setting $PYTHONHOME to <prefix>[:<exec_prefix>] > Hello, Python! > > My $PYTHONHOME bash variable is /opt/python. The python executable is in > /opt/python/bin/python. > > What am I doing wrong here? > > -- Stephen Not sure what the problem might be, looks to be something to do with the way it's installed. You would get more information from python -v script-name or even just python -v This will tell you if the error is occurring in automatically- executed module code before the interpreter gets around to your script. regards Steve -- "If computing ever stops being fun, I'll stop doing it"
